Show full item recordAbstract
The steady, pressure-driven flow of a Herschel-Bulkley fluid in a channel is considered assuming that slip occurs on one wall only due to slip heterogeneities. Hence, the velocity profile is allowed to be asymmetric. The fully-developed solutions are derived and the different flow regimes are identified. The development of the flow is investigated numerically using the Papanastasiou regularization for the constitutive equation, a power-law slip equation, and finite element simulations. The combined effects of slip and the Bingham number are discussed.
